The Best 2023 LIVE: Brazil wins the FIFA fair play award 2023
The Brazilian national team wins the award for its fight against racism, represented in the black jersey in the friendly against Guinea at the Santiago Bernabeu in June 2023.
The Best 2023 LIVE: Mary Earps named The Best women's GK
Mary Earps is named The Best FIFA Women's Goalkeeper 2023. The Manchester United and England goalkeeper retains the award.
The Best 2023, LIVE: the FIFA FIFFPRO Best XI
The FIFA Best XI is revealed. Manchester City are in the spotlight with six players.
Goalkeeper: Thibaut Courtois
Defence: John Stones, Kyle Walker, Ruben Dias
Midfield: Bernardo Silva, Jude Bellingham, Kevin De Bruyne
Forwards: Erling Haaland, Kylian Mbappe, Lionel Messi, Vinicius Jr

The Best 2023, LIVE: who voted for the awards?
FIFA has released a list of some of the voters for the men's and women's awards. Their panel of experts includes Petr Cech, Didier Drogba, Brett Emerton, Rio Ferdinand, Asamoah Gyan, Kaka, Mario Kempes, Alexi Lalas, Jon Obi Mikel, Park Ji-Sung and Ivan Vicelich.
